Twin1 AI raises $20M to put an AI twin behind every knowledge worker
Twin1 AI Inc. launched today with $20 million in seed funding to build artificial intelligence-powered digital twins that carry an individual professional’s expertise across their organization.
The San Mateo, California-based startup pairs each worker with a persistent model of their own knowledge, judgment and working context, one that can answer questions and act on that person’s behalf. Twin1 was founded in 2025 by Lewis Liu, Tom Cahn, Huiting Liu and Jonathan Budd (pictured) and also runs a team in London.
Three of the four founders came out of Eigen Technologies Ltd., the London document AI company that sold to SirionLabs Inc. in 2024 after raising more than $80 million. Lewis Liu, Twin1’s chief executive, co-founded Eigen and led it through that sale.
A twin draws on its users’ email, meeting records, documents and connected workplace systems, and it works inside Slack, Microsoft Teams, Outlook, Gmail, Google Drive and SharePoint. Permissions run through the user, who sets which of those sources the twin reads and which colleagues are allowed to query it.
That last part is the pitch. Twin1 layers six sets of rules-based and AI-based controls over both peer-to-peer and peer-to-AI exchanges, blending corporate policy, inherited permissions and human sign-off so that a twin surfaces information only where the requester is already entitled to it.
Above the individual twins sits the Twin Network, a coordination layer through which twins locate the right colleague, collect permission-aware knowledge and hand work between teams. The company also offers an enterprise Model Context Protocol server, letting other agents and enterprise applications pull governed context from one twin or from the network.
Twin1 has been running with customers in legal, financial services and energy for more than a year rather than arriving cold. Named users include Linklaters LLP, Orrick, Herrington & Sutcliffe LLP, Dechert LLP, Customers Bank and Aegis Energy. The company says those customers report the platform handling 30% to 50% of the communications work their knowledge workers would otherwise do themselves.
“In every knowledge organization, the human is the atomic unit of knowledge,” Liu said in the funding announcement. He argued that most enterprise AI averages out what individual employees know and said Twin1 was built to keep that expertise attached to the person who has it.
Orrick Chief Innovation Officer Wendy Butler Curtis said the platform lets the firm mine its collective data and called it “one of the most exciting developments in the practice today.” Orrick also took a strategic stake in the round.
Bessemer Venture Partners, Tribeca Venture Partners and Aramco Ventures co-led the seed round. EJF Ventures, Tin Alley Ventures, AGI House Ventures, Neo, F-Prime Capital, Btech Consortium, Antiportfolio Ventures, Lakestar and Notion Capital also invested, alongside angels including Wiz Inc. co-founder Roy Reznik, Notable Capital Managing Partner Hans Tung and Dawn Capital co-founder Haakon Overli. Several of them backed Eigen.
The money goes to hiring in San Mateo and London, sales and marketing, and further work on the platform. Liu told Artificial Lawyer that Twin1 is working through a pipeline of more than 400 prospects and plans to follow the enterprise product with a self-service version aimed at smaller firms and individual professionals.
